Hey all,

Just installed Xubuntu on my workstation here at 
the office, and copied the lines over from the old 
  /etc/fstab file to the new install:

192.168.0.100:/home 
/mnt/BSP_home           nfs     rw      0       0
192.168.0.101:/home 
/mnt/VP_home            nfs     rw      0       0
192.168.0.101:/usr 
/mnt/VP_usr             nfs     rw      0       0
192.168.0.101:/usr/local/projects 
/mnt/VP_projects        nfs     rw      0       0

But they are not mounting at boot, and mount -a 
runs for a very long time before finally mounting 
them.

If they are in fstab shouldn't they be mounted at 
boot?

Why does mount -a take so long to mount them?

I should say the two machines they are mounting 
are running FreeBSD 6.0.
